Get,
Microeconomics and Macroeconomics books by Mankiw for Paper I Economic Development by Todaro & Smith for Paper II Economy of Pakistan by Saeed for Paper II And keep reading Sakib Sherani & Khurram Hussain in Dawn, and Dr Muhammad Yaqub in The News if you can't read EBR by Dawn on a regular basis. PS: You don't have to stick to the syllabus book and there is no reason to assume that the paper-setters would. It is just an indicative list and has some preposterous suggestions such as Population Problems by Thompson & Lewis and the Government Finance book. Though you can definitely savour the luxury of reading such books once you've mastered the basic Micro, Macro, and Development economics. |
